Political factors
Government regulations heavily influence the HVAC sector, especially concerning energy efficiency and refrigerants. The EPA's AIM Act mandates phasing out high-GWP refrigerants. This shift to lower-GWP alternatives, like those with a GWP of 750 or less, is required by 2025. This will affect equipment design and installation.
Government infrastructure spending, including on schools and public buildings, directly impacts HVAC and electrical service demand. The Infrastructure Investment and Jobs Act (IIJA) presents opportunities for Comfort Systems USA. However, future investment levels may fluctuate based on political changes. The IIJA allocated roughly $550 billion for infrastructure projects. In 2024, the US construction spending reached approximately $2 trillion, indicating potential growth for Comfort Systems.
Political stability and trade policies are crucial. Tariffs impact material costs and supply chains for HVAC and electrical systems. In 2024, tariffs on Chinese imports remain a key factor, potentially raising costs. The U.S. and China trade relationship continues to evolve, influencing the industry. Changes in policy create both risks and opportunities.
Energy Policy and Incentives
Government energy policies significantly impact Comfort Systems' operations. Incentives for energy-efficient systems and electrification drive demand for their services. The political environment affects the funding and focus on clean energy. For example, the Inflation Reduction Act of 2022 allocated $369 billion to climate and energy programs. This will likely boost demand.

Building Codes and Standards
Building codes and standards significantly influence HVAC and electrical system design, installation, and maintenance. Compliance is critical for companies like Comfort Systems. The U.S. Energy Department updates building energy codes, with the 2021 International Energy Conservation Code (IECC) expected to reduce energy consumption by 9.3% compared to the 2018 version. These changes necessitate adjustments in operational practices and product offerings. Staying current with these evolving regulations is vital for sustained success.

Economic factors
Comfort Systems USA's fortunes are closely tied to construction market health. The commercial, industrial, and institutional sectors are key. Manufacturing and public safety construction are currently robust. However, multifamily and commercial projects could slow due to interest rate impacts. In 2024, U.S. construction spending totaled approximately $2 trillion.
Interest rate shifts significantly impact borrowing costs for Comfort Systems and its clients. Reduced rates can spur investment in construction and renovations, boosting demand for HVAC and electrical services. Conversely, elevated rates might curb new projects, favoring repairs over replacements. For instance, in early 2024, the Federal Reserve held steady, but future decisions will affect project financing and consumer spending. The prime rate was around 8.5% in May 2024, impacting financing costs.
Inflation and escalating material costs, notably for copper and steel, directly affect project profitability. Recent data indicates a 5-7% increase in these costs in Q1 2024. Supply chain issues, as seen in late 2023 and early 2024, further strain costs and cause delays, potentially extending project timelines by 10-15%.
Labor Costs and Availability
Labor costs and the availability of skilled workers, like HVAC technicians and electricians, are crucial economic factors for Comfort Systems. A scarcity of skilled labor can drive up costs, potentially impacting project timelines and profitability. As of early 2024, the HVAC industry faces a persistent skills gap. The Bureau of Labor Statistics projects about 47,000 openings for HVAC mechanics and installers each year, on average, over the decade.
- HVAC technician median pay was $54,690 in May 2023.
- The industry is projected to grow 6% from 2022 to 2032.
- Labor shortages could limit Comfort Systems' project capacity.
- Increased labor costs may necessitate higher project bids.

Sociological factors
Growing public awareness of IAQ, fueled by health concerns and the COVID-19 pandemic, boosts demand for IAQ solutions. The IAQ market is projected to reach $13.6 billion by 2025, with a CAGR of 7.5% from 2020 to 2025. Comfort Systems can capitalize on this trend.
Comfort Systems USA benefits from aging infrastructure, with older buildings requiring HVAC and electrical system upgrades. The U.S. infrastructure bill, with around $1 trillion allocated, boosts this. In 2024, the market for HVAC services is estimated at $130 billion, growing annually. Retrofits offer consistent revenue streams.
Population growth and urbanization fuel construction, boosting HVAC and electrical system demand. In 2024, the global population reached 8 billion, with urban areas expanding rapidly. For example, the U.S. housing starts in April 2024 were at a seasonally adjusted annual rate of 1.36 million, signaling growth. This trend directly impacts Comfort Systems.

Workforce Demographics and Skilled Trades Perception
Comfort Systems USA faces workforce demographic shifts, particularly an aging workforce and potential skilled trades shortages. Attracting and training new talent is crucial to meet future demand, especially given the construction industry's reliance on skilled labor. The Bureau of Labor Statistics projects a need for approximately 546,000 new construction workers between 2022 and 2024. This requires proactive measures to ensure a sustainable workforce. The industry's perception also influences recruitment and retention efforts.
- Aging Workforce: The median age of construction workers is increasing, with a significant portion nearing retirement.
- Skills Gap: There is a growing gap between the skills available and the skills required, especially in areas like HVAC and electrical work.
- Training Initiatives: Companies are investing in apprenticeships and training programs to develop the next generation of skilled tradespeople.
- Attraction Strategies: Efforts to attract younger workers include promoting the benefits of trade careers, such as competitive salaries and opportunities for advancement.

Technological factors
Technological progress is driving innovations in HVAC and electrical systems. This includes the adoption of VRF systems, heat pumps, and improved filtration. The global smart HVAC market is projected to reach $42.1 billion by 2025. This increase in efficiency and intelligence is transforming building management.
The incorporation of smart tech and IoT is transforming HVAC. This enables remote monitoring and boosts energy efficiency. In 2024, the smart HVAC market reached $10.2 billion. It's projected to hit $23.5 billion by 2029. This growth enhances Comfort Systems' offerings.
Artificial Intelligence (AI) and data analytics are transforming HVAC systems. AI optimizes energy use, diagnoses issues, and boosts efficiency. This leads to proactive maintenance and enhanced system performance. For example, in 2024, AI-driven HVAC systems saw a 15% reduction in energy consumption.

New Refrigerant Technology
The shift away from high Global Warming Potential (GWP) refrigerants is a significant technological factor for Comfort Systems. This transition, mandated by regulations like the EPA's AIM Act, necessitates new refrigerant technologies. These changes influence equipment design and demand updated technician training. For example, the market for low-GWP refrigerants is projected to reach $4.2 billion by 2025.
- The AIM Act aims to reduce HFC production and consumption by 85% by 2036.
- Adoption of new refrigerants may increase equipment costs initially but offers long-term energy efficiency benefits.

Legal factors
The Environmental Protection Agency (EPA) enforces regulations impacting Comfort Systems. The AIM Act drives the phase-out of high-GWP refrigerants, demanding adherence. New energy efficiency standards for HVAC systems are also mandated by law. Compliance is essential to avoid legal penalties. The EPA's focus on sustainability influences operational strategies.
Comfort Systems USA must comply with building codes and safety standards, which vary by location. These regulations dictate materials, installation methods, and inspections. Non-compliance can lead to project delays, fines, and legal issues. In 2024, the construction industry faced $1.2 billion in penalties for code violations.
OSHA regulations significantly impact Comfort Systems. These rules mandate safe work environments, especially critical in construction and HVAC services. In 2024, OSHA reported over 5,000 workplace fatalities, highlighting the importance of compliance. Non-compliance can lead to hefty fines, potentially costing companies like Comfort Systems millions. Ensuring employee safety is both a legal and financial imperative.
Licensing and Certification Requirements
Comfort Systems USA must navigate complex licensing and certification requirements. HVAC and electrical contractors need specific licenses to operate, ensuring compliance with local and state regulations. These requirements vary by location, adding complexity to their operations. New regulations, like those for handling refrigerants, necessitate continuous training and certification updates.
- EPA Section 608 certification is essential for technicians handling refrigerants.
- State-specific licensing fees and renewal costs impact operational expenses.
- Failure to comply can result in significant fines and operational disruptions.

Environmental factors
Refrigerants' GWP significantly impacts the environment. HVAC systems face stricter regulations to reduce their carbon footprint. The EPA's AIM Act phases out high-GWP refrigerants. Transitioning to low-GWP alternatives costs around $100-$300 per unit. This drives innovation and strategic shifts in the industry.
HVAC systems are major energy users. There's a rising emphasis on boosting energy efficiency to cut consumption and emissions. In 2024, the US commercial sector spent ~$190 billion on energy, with HVAC a key part. Efficiency improvements can significantly lower operational costs and environmental impact. The push for green buildings and sustainability drives this trend.
Green building initiatives are gaining traction, promoting eco-friendly construction. Certifications drive sustainable practices, boosting demand for energy-efficient HVAC solutions. The global green building materials market is projected to reach $439.1 billion by 2025. This growth reflects a shift towards sustainable building practices. Comfort Systems can capitalize on this trend.
Climate Change and Extreme Weather
Climate change intensifies extreme weather, boosting the need for dependable HVAC systems. This can shorten equipment lifespans and affect performance. The U.S. experienced 28 weather/climate disasters in 2023, each exceeding $1 billion in damages. Extreme heat days are rising; 2023 saw record highs across the globe.
- 2023's extreme weather caused over $92.9 billion in damages in the U.S.
- Global temperatures continue to rise, with 2024 projected to be even hotter.
- Demand for energy-efficient HVAC systems is increasing.
Waste Management and Recycling
Comfort Systems USA must navigate waste management and recycling regulations. Proper disposal of old HVAC equipment and refrigerants is crucial. Environmental compliance can impact operational costs and reputation. Recent data shows the HVAC industry is under increasing scrutiny regarding refrigerant emissions, with the EPA targeting significant reductions by 2025.
- The EPA finalized rules to phase down HFCs, aiming for an 85% reduction by 2036.
- HVAC companies face potential fines for improper refrigerant handling.
- Recycling programs for refrigerants are becoming increasingly important.
